Yes the ambient temp, air temp and coolant temp are all around the same values.

I’ve got some more codes off my reader today.
ECM-0605
ECM-060C

I’m guessing these are to do with the Engine Control Module?
Yes, they are Engine Control Module codes.

Using this site https://en.bsr.se/read-more/dtc-codes to identify what they mean, shows the that
ECM-0605 = Engine control module (ECM). Internal fault

ECM-060C = Engine control module (ECM). Internal fault/Fuel injection system driver Faulty signal

I take you've already tried powering down the system, i.e. battery disconnected for an hour or so in the slim chance that it's a software glitch?
